Cleaning the Tubes on the Optimizer Series
« on: January 03, 2013, 10:50:52 PM »

Thought some of you owners of the Portage and Main Optimizer series might like this bit of info.  I find the vertical tubes are not the easiest to clean especially if you are burning less than optimal wood.  In my case cleaning once a week is more realistic.  Anyhow to simplify the process once a week, I open the  damper on the Blower Motor up to approximately 1/2 inch and let it run this way for a couple of hours  You will also notice that a considerable amount of the creosote inside the firepot burns away as well.  Then use your brush to give the tubes a final clean out, reposition the blower damper back to where it belongs 1/4 inch open and you should be good to go.  Basically works like a Self Clean cycle!
